Young Adulting Review was founded in 2019 at the UBC School of Creative Writing as a place for thoughtful, serious discussion of books for children and young adults. Over the last four years, we’ve published hundreds of reviews, author interviews, and news breakdowns, and have brought countless new critical voices to the Canadian children’s literature scene. Our reviews have been read and shared by authors and readers around the world, and our site draws thousands of visitors every year. 

Now entering our fifth year, Young Adulting Review is expanding our scope. We noticed a gap in the publishing sphere: While there are many places to submit and publish short literary fiction online, very few such places exist for writers of short fiction for children and young adults to publicize their work.

That’s why Young Adulting Review is thrilled to announce the First Page Feature! 

The First Page Feature is a chance for emerging writers to feature the first page of their works-in-progress (ranging from Middle Grade to New Adult) in our monthly newsletter. Getting featured includes the opportunity for emerging writers to publicize themselves and their work as well as answer three interview questions to share their creative process and writing journey.
